What happens if my cat licks lemon juice?

If your cat licks lemon juice, the citric acid could cause an upset stomach. Symptoms may include vomiting, diarrhea, and abdominal pain. If your cat ingests a large amount of lemon juice, it could also lead to dehydration.

So, it’s best to keep lemons and lemon juice out of reach of your feline friend.

Cats are known for their finicky nature when it comes to what they will and won’t eat or drink. So, can cats have lemon water? The answer is both yes and no.

While a small amount of lemon water is not likely to harm your cat, it is also not likely to be enjoyed. Cats have a strong sense of smell and taste and lemons are simply too strong for their delicate palates. In fact, most cats will avoid anything that smells or tastes like lemon.

If you do decide to give your cat some lemon water, make sure it is diluted well and only offer a small amount. And, be prepared for your cat to turn up its nose!

Is lemon juice bad for cats skin

If you’re looking for a natural way to cleanse your cat’s skin, you may be wondering if lemon juice is a good option. Unfortunately, lemon juice is not recommended for use on cats. While it may be safe for some cats in small amounts, it can cause irritation and skin problems for others.

If you’re concerned about your cat’s skin health, it’s best to consult with a veterinarian before using any home remedies.
